Can I return liquor purchased from Costco?

Yes, Costco has a generous return policy that includes liquor. If for any reason you are not satisfied with your liquor purchase, you can return it to the store with your receipt for a full refund. This applies whether the bottle is opened or unopened, making it easier for customers to try new products without the risk of loss.

However, keep in mind that local laws and Costco’s policies may influence return conditions, so it’s always good to check with your local store for any specific requirements. Overall, this policy provides peace of mind for customers, ensuring that they can shop confidently for their liquor needs at Costco.

Is there an age requirement to purchase liquor at Costco in Florida?

Yes, there is an age requirement to purchase liquor at Costco, as well as all liquor stores in Florida. Customers must be at least 21 years old to buy alcohol. This is in accordance with both state and federal laws regarding the sale of alcoholic beverages.

When purchasing liquor at Costco, you will need to provide a valid form of identification to verify your age. It’s advisable to ensure that your ID is not expired, as this could delay or prevent your purchase. Costco’s staff will check IDs of any customer who appears to be under 30 to ensure compliance with the age requirement.

Do liquor prices at Costco differ from other retailers in Florida?

Generally, liquor prices at Costco tend to be lower than those at many traditional retailers. This is largely because Costco operates on a membership model and can leverage higher volume sales to negotiate better prices from suppliers. Additionally, Costco’s focus on bulk sales allows them to pass savings on to their customers.

However, it’s essential to compare prices with nearby liquor stores, as some specific brands and products might vary in price depending on local promotions or availability.
